What is a remote interventional radiology RN?

A Remote Interventional Radiology RN is a registered nurse who provides support and care for patients undergoing interventional radiology procedures, but does so via telehealth or remote platforms rather than in person. Their responsibilities include patient education, pre- and post-procedure assessments, care coordination, and sometimes monitoring patients during procedures using remote technology. This role allows healthcare facilities to extend specialized nursing care to more patients, often in underserved or rural areas, by leveraging digital communication tools.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a remote interventional radiology RN?

To thrive as a Remote Interventional Radiology RN, you need a solid foundation in nursing practice, radiology procedures, and patient assessment, usually supported by an active RN license and specialized experience in interventional radiology. Familiarity with teleradiology platforms, PACS, EMR systems, and certifications like ACLS or CRN are typically required. Excellent communication, critical thinking, and the ability to collaborate effectively in a virtual environment are vital soft skills. These competencies ensure safe, high-quality patient care and seamless coordination with remote healthcare teams and radiologists.

What are some common challenges faced by remote interventional radiology RNs, and how can they be addressed?

Remote Interventional Radiology RNs often encounter challenges such as coordinating care across multiple sites, maintaining effective communication with physicians and on-site teams, and staying updated on procedural protocols. To address these, it's essential to leverage secure telehealth platforms, establish clear communication channels, and participate in regular team meetings or case reviews. Embracing continuous education and fostering strong collaboration with technologists and radiologists can also help ensure high-quality patient care and smooth workflow.
